Transaction 0759f26b93f660ac5ea59a0671b280c5cc2b9ee2962900510c931e6e409576b8
1 Input
1 Output
-
0759f26b93f660ac5ea59a0671b280c5cc2b9ee2962900510c931e6e409576b8:0
- value
- 13117317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ae09b107ecddf33b855491750afef06ae122942 OP_EQUAL
- address
- 374LBYnyC8ZLRr9BZajQ3ntTJdHXXRBDuM